hi All,
the Zebralist appears to be relatively inactive.
anyone here have experience indexing MARC binaries
with zebra?
[log in to unmask]
-------- Original Message --------
Subject: zebraidx errors, and zebrasrv ERROR 121
Date: Thu, 12 Jun 2008 12:47:40 -0700
From: [log in to unmask] <[log in to unmask]>
To: Zebralist <[log in to unmask]>
CC: Sebastian Hammer <[log in to unmask]>, siznax <[log in to unmask]>
hi All,
setting up my first zebra server, and i'm rather new to Z39.50,
so any suggestions at all would be greatly appreciated. i'm
using Zebra 2.0.32, Configured as: i486-pc-linux-gnu,
Using ICU.
1) i've been given a MARC binary that appears to have local
numbers in the 099 field (see below [a]), so i want to be
able to do something like: find @attr 1=12 BT-3551
2) first, i tried specifying recordType: grs.marc.usmarc
3) and modified the usmarc.abs config table as follows:
elm 099 local-number !
4) i got a few warnings ([b]) when i tried to index
the data with the grs.mar.usmarc filter, and got
ERROR 121 from zebrasrv ([c,d]).
5) so, i tried using the dom.conf/dom-conf.xml
recordtype. i got a different zebraidx error, and
similar zebrasrv results ([e,f,g]).
6) lastly, i tried using recordtype: grs.marc.marc21
7) modified marc21.abs as follows:
melm 099 local
8) i got lots of warnings from zebraidx, and the
same error (ERROR 121) from zebrasrv.
do you think my MARC binary is corrupt? any suggestions?
[log in to unmask]
references:
------------------------------------------------
[a] example record:
000 01165nam 2200193Ia 45e0
008 080519s9999 xx 000 0 und d
099 09 $aBT-3551 ed
100 0 $aH.G. Heinrich, et al
245 00 $aResearch and Development of Rigid, Rising, ...
260 \\ $\$c1963
300 \\ $\$a51 p.
500 $a24-Jul-63
500 $aScientific Report, 51 p, 9 refs
520 $aAn attempt has been made to analyze several ...
536 $aAir Force Cambridge Research Labs.$bAF 19(628)-2393
690 $aWind measurement
690 $aWind profiles
690 $aComputer models
720 2 $aG.T. Schjeldahl Co.
------------------------------------------------
[b] grs.marc.usmarc zebraidx warnings:
root@loon:/usr/share/idzebra-2.0-examples/goddard# zebraidx -c
conf/zebra.cfg update data
zebraidx(17054) [log] zebra_start 2.0.32 conf/zebra.cfg
zebraidx(17054)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-grs-marc.so
zebraidx(17054)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-dom.so
zebraidx(17054)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-text.so
zebraidx(17054)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-grs-regx.so
zebraidx(17054)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-grs-xml.so
zebraidx(17054)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-alvis.so
zebraidx(17054) [log] enabling shadow spec=tmp:10G
zebraidx(17054) [log] cache_fname = tmp/cache
zebraidx(17054) [log] dir data
zebraidx(17054) [log] add grs.marc.usmarc data/goddard-testmarc.mrc 0
zebraidx(17054) [log] add grs.marc.usmarc data/goddard-testmarc.mrc 1165
zebraidx(17054) [log] add grs.marc.usmarc data/goddard-testmarc.mrc 2107
zebraidx(17054) [log] add grs.marc.usmarc data/goddard-testmarc.mrc 3226
zebraidx(17054) [log] add grs.marc.usmarc data/goddard-testmarc.mrc 3881
zebraidx(17054) [log] add grs.marc.usmarc data/goddard-testmarc.mrc 4592
zebraidx(17054) [log] add grs.marc.usmarc data/goddard-testmarc.mrc 5243
zebraidx(17054) [warn] MARC: Skipping bad byte 60 (0x3C)
zebraidx(17054) [warn] MARC: Skipping bad byte 63 (0x3F)
zebraidx(17054) [warn] MARC: Skipping bad byte 120 (0x78)
zebraidx(17054) [warn] MARC: Skipping bad byte 109 (0x6D)
zebraidx(17054) [warn] MARC: Skipping bad byte 108 (0x6C)
zebraidx(17054) [warn] MARC: Skipping bad byte 32 (0x20)
zebraidx(17054) [warn] MARC: Skipping bad byte 118 (0x76)
zebraidx(17054) [warn] MARC: Skipping bad byte 101 (0x65)
zebraidx(17054) [warn] MARC: Skipping bad byte 114 (0x72)
zebraidx(17054) [warn] MARC: Skipping bad byte 115 (0x73)
zebraidx(17054) [warn] MARC: Skipping bad byte 105 (0x69)
zebraidx(17054) [warn] MARC: Skipping bad byte 111 (0x6F)
zebraidx(17054) [warn] MARC: Skipping bad byte 110 (0x6E)
zebraidx(17054) [warn] MARC: Skipping bad byte 61 (0x3D)
zebraidx(17054) [warn] MARC: Skipping bad byte 34 (0x22)
zebraidx(17054) [warn] MARC record length < 25, is 10
zebraidx(17054) [warn] MARC: Skipping bad byte 60 (0x3C)
zebraidx(17054) [warn] MARC: Skipping bad byte 63 (0x3F)
zebraidx(17054) [warn] MARC: Skipping bad byte 120 (0x78)
zebraidx(17054) [warn] MARC: Skipping bad byte 109 (0x6D)
zebraidx(17054) [warn] MARC: Skipping bad byte 108 (0x6C)
zebraidx(17054) [warn] MARC: Skipping bad byte 32 (0x20)
zebraidx(17054) [warn] MARC: Skipping bad byte 118 (0x76)
zebraidx(17054) [warn] MARC: Skipping bad byte 101 (0x65)
zebraidx(17054) [warn] MARC: Skipping bad byte 114 (0x72)
zebraidx(17054) [warn] MARC: Skipping bad byte 115 (0x73)
zebraidx(17054) [warn] MARC: Skipping bad byte 105 (0x69)
zebraidx(17054) [warn] MARC: Skipping bad byte 111 (0x6F)
zebraidx(17054) [warn] MARC: Skipping bad byte 110 (0x6E)
zebraidx(17054) [warn] MARC: Skipping bad byte 61 (0x3D)
zebraidx(17054) [warn] MARC: Skipping bad byte 34 (0x22)
zebraidx(17054) [warn] MARC record length < 25, is 10
zebraidx(17054) [log] Iterations: isam/dict 422/219
zebraidx(17054) [log] Dict: inserts/updates/deletions: 219/0/0
zebraidx(17054) [log] Records: 7 i/u/d 7/0/0
zebraidx(17054) [log] zebra_stop: 0.03 0.01 0.00
[c] grs.marc.usmarc zebrasrv errors:
find @attr 1=12 BT-3551
Diagnostic message(s) from database:
[121] Unsupported Attribute Set -- v2 addinfo '0'
find @attr 1=4 research
Diagnostic message(s) from database:
[121] Unsupported Attribute Set -- v2 addinfo '0'
[d] grs.marc.usmarc zebrasrv log:
zebrasrv(1) [request] Search Default ERROR 121 3 1+0 RPN @attrset Bib-1
@attr 1=4 research
zebrasrv(1) [request] Search Default ERROR 121 2 1+0 RPN @attrset Bib-1
@attr 1=12 BT-3551
------------------------------------------------
[e] dom-conf.xml zebrasrv errors:
zebraidx(16915) [log] zebra_start 2.0.32 conf/zebra.cfg
zebraidx(16915)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-grs-marc.so
zebraidx(16915)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-dom.so
zebraidx(16915)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-text.so
zebraidx(16915)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-grs-regx.so
zebraidx(16915)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-grs-xml.so
zebraidx(16915)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-alvis.so
zebraidx(16915) [log] enabling shadow spec=tmp:10G
zebraidx(16915) [log] cache_fname = tmp/cache
zebraidx(16915) [log] dir data
zebraidx(16915) [log] conf/dom-conf.xml dom filter: loading config file
./conf/dom-conf.xml
parser error : Document is empty
93Ia 45e000800410000009900150004110000250005624501670008126000100
zebraidx(16915) [log] add dom.conf/dom-conf.xml data/debug-utf8-record.xml 0
zebraidx(16915) [log] add dom.conf/dom-conf.xml data/debug-record.xml 0
zebraidx(16915) [log] add dom.conf/dom-conf.xml data/debug-record.xml 4100
zebraidx(16915) [log] add dom.conf/dom-conf.xml data/debug-record.xml 4100
zebraidx(16915) [log] add dom.conf/dom-conf.xml data/debug-record.xml 4100
zebraidx(16915) [log] add dom.conf/dom-conf.xml data/debug-record.xml 4100
zebraidx(16915) [log] Iterations: isam/dict 289/156
zebraidx(16915) [log] Dict: inserts/updates/deletions: 156/0/0
zebraidx(16915) [log] Records: 6 i/u/d 6/0/0
zebraidx(16915) [log] zebra_stop: 0.03 0.01 0.01
[f] dom-conf.xml zebrasrv errors:
find @attr 1=12 BT-3551
Diagnostic message(s) from database:
[121] Unsupported Attribute Set -- v2 addinfo '0'
find @attr 1=4 research
Diagnostic message(s) from database:
[121] Unsupported Attribute Set -- v2 addinfo '0'
[g] dom-conf.xml zebrasrv log:
[request] Search Default ERROR 121 3 1+0 RPN @attrset Bib-1 @attr 1=12
BT-3551
[request] Search Default ERROR 121 4 1+0 RPN @attrset Bib-1 @attr 1=4
research
------------------------------------------------
[h] grs.marc.marc21 zebraidx log:
root@loon:/usr/share/idzebra-2.0-examples/goddard# zebraidx -c
conf/zebra.cfg update data
zebraidx(17237) [log] zebra_start 2.0.32 conf/zebra.cfg
zebraidx(17237)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-grs-marc.so
zebraidx(17237)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-dom.so
zebraidx(17237)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-text.so
zebraidx(17237)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-grs-regx.so
zebraidx(17237)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-grs-xml.so
zebraidx(17237) [log] Loaded filter module
/usr/lib/idzebra-2.0/modules/mod-alvis.so
zebraidx(17237) [log] enabling shadow spec=tmp:10G
zebraidx(17237) [log] cache_fname = tmp/cache
zebraidx(17237) [log] dir data
zebraidx(17237) [log] add grs.marc.marc21 data/goddard-testmarc.mrc 0
zebraidx(17237) [log] add grs.marc.marc21 data/goddard-testmarc.mrc 1165
zebraidx(17237) [log] add grs.marc.marc21 data/goddard-testmarc.mrc 2107
zebraidx(17237) [log] add grs.marc.marc21 data/goddard-testmarc.mrc 3226
zebraidx(17237) [log] add grs.marc.marc21 data/goddard-testmarc.mrc 3881
zebraidx(17237) [log] add grs.marc.marc21 data/goddard-testmarc.mrc 4592
zebraidx(17237) [log] add grs.marc.marc21 data/goddard-testmarc.mrc 5243
zebraidx(17237) [warn] MARC: Skipping bad byte 60 (0x3C)
zebraidx(17237) [warn] MARC: Skipping bad byte 63 (0x3F)
zebraidx(17237) [warn] MARC: Skipping bad byte 120 (0x78)
zebraidx(17237) [warn] MARC: Skipping bad byte 109 (0x6D)
zebraidx(17237) [warn] MARC: Skipping bad byte 108 (0x6C)
zebraidx(17237) [warn] MARC: Skipping bad byte 32 (0x20)
zebraidx(17237) [warn] MARC: Skipping bad byte 118 (0x76)
zebraidx(17237) [warn] MARC: Skipping bad byte 101 (0x65)
zebraidx(17237) [warn] MARC: Skipping bad byte 114 (0x72)
zebraidx(17237) [warn] MARC: Skipping bad byte 115 (0x73)
zebraidx(17237) [warn] MARC: Skipping bad byte 105 (0x69)
zebraidx(17237) [warn] MARC: Skipping bad byte 111 (0x6F)
zebraidx(17237) [warn] MARC: Skipping bad byte 110 (0x6E)
zebraidx(17237) [warn] MARC: Skipping bad byte 61 (0x3D)
zebraidx(17237) [warn] MARC: Skipping bad byte 34 (0x22)
zebraidx(17237) [warn] MARC record length < 25, is 10
zebraidx(17237) [warn] MARC: Skipping bad byte 60 (0x3C)
zebraidx(17237) [warn] MARC: Skipping bad byte 63 (0x3F)
zebraidx(17237) [warn] MARC: Skipping bad byte 120 (0x78)
zebraidx(17237) [warn] MARC: Skipping bad byte 109 (0x6D)
zebraidx(17237) [warn] MARC: Skipping bad byte 108 (0x6C)
zebraidx(17237) [warn] MARC: Skipping bad byte 32 (0x20)
zebraidx(17237) [warn] MARC: Skipping bad byte 118 (0x76)
zebraidx(17237) [warn] MARC: Skipping bad byte 101 (0x65)
zebraidx(17237) [warn] MARC: Skipping bad byte 114 (0x72)
zebraidx(17237) [warn] MARC: Skipping bad byte 115 (0x73)
zebraidx(17237) [warn] MARC: Skipping bad byte 105 (0x69)
zebraidx(17237) [warn] MARC: Skipping bad byte 111 (0x6F)
zebraidx(17237) [warn] MARC: Skipping bad byte 110 (0x6E)
zebraidx(17237) [warn] MARC: Skipping bad byte 61 (0x3D)
zebraidx(17237) [warn] MARC: Skipping bad byte 34 (0x22)
zebraidx(17237) [warn] MARC record length < 25, is 10
zebraidx(17237) [log] Iterations: isam/dict 104/28
zebraidx(17237) [log] Dict: inserts/updates/deletions: 28/0/0
zebraidx(17237) [log] Records: 7 i/u/d 7/0/0
zebraidx(17237) [log] zebra_stop: 0.07 0.01 0.00
[i] grs.marc.marc21 zebraidx log:
find @attr 1=12 BT-3551
Diagnostic message(s) from database:
[121] Unsupported Attribute Set -- v2 addinfo '0'
find @attr 1=4 research
Diagnostic message(s) from database:
[121] Unsupported Attribute Set -- v2 addinfo '0'
[j] grs.marc.marc21 zebraidx log:
[request] Search Default ERROR 121 3 1+0 RPN @attrset Bib-1 @attr 1=12
BT-3551
[request] Search Default ERROR 121 4 1+0 RPN @attrset Bib-1 @attr 1=4
research
|